Ticket: Guest Wi-Fi desk, Thistledown House reception.

Request: Dedicated desk for visiting contractors needing guest network access. Power strip installed; signage pending. Contractors should sign the day log before use. Desk drawer holds spare ethernet cables; drawer is locked overnight. Facilities to unlock each morning using the code below.

turnstile pass: bdg-TXR-4

Subject: Quickstore 4.2 — bloom filter now fronts the KV layer

Plugin authors: starting with this release, Quickstore places a bloom filter ahead of the key-value store. Negative lookups return faster; false positives fall through safely. No API changes are required on your side. Verify your plugin against the staging build referenced below.

session token of fahif-tadup = htk3_9c7

Subject: Cut-over summary — export retry pipeline

Hi Soren,

The cut-over of Quillbatch's export retry pipeline completed Saturday night. Failed exports now queue to the new retry worker with exponential backoff, replacing the manual replay script. We verified that retried payloads are re-signed and that dead-lettered items require an approval step before reprocessing. No data left the Varnholt environment during the transition. For your review, the production worker runs with the following configuration values.

deployment values, kajep-kageg:
[praix]
host = praix.paliqcorp.corp
user = praix_svc
database = praix_prod

Overall the Fennelwick schema registry changes look solid, and I appreciate the careful handling of backward-compatibility checks on event envelope versions. One concern before we cut the release: the compatibility cache eviction logic interacts with the new subject-lookup retry loop, and under load those two could thrash. I verified locally that the defaults below keep lookup latency under 40ms at our projected event volume. Please confirm these match the staging overrides before sign-off.

tuning constants:
RATE_LIMITS = {
    "ralwyn": 5,
    "zorael": 2,
}